Scribe & Scoring Clinic was held on November 7, 2009 from 1-5 p.m. This clinic was held at the
beautiful home of Meghan & Greg Markham, were we all stayed warm and dry on a wet Saturday
afternoon. The club supplied beverages, croissant sandwiches, and cheese & crackers!  The turnout was
great, people came from as far as Issaquah & Yelm to attend our clubs first Scribing & Scoring clinic.
Some of those who attended had some scribing experience and others had little or no experience. Robin
Cummins taught a very informative class and everyone left with a good understanding about what it takes
to be a scribe at both schooling & recognized show levels.  At the end of the lecture there was a video
scribing session, which added a real-time scribing experience.  At first some struggled, but by the time
they finished training level and began first level, everyone felt as though they were ready to scribe at their
first schooling show.  During the last hour of the clinic, Robin with the help of Karen Fisher worked with
those who were interested in actually scoring the tests they had just scribed.  All the ladies went home
with scribing and scoring certificates of completion from LPSDC.

Class details:  
I am going to limit these classes to 4 riders/horses.  
There will be several riding patterns, including cavallettis
 and cones.  Centered Riding exercises (mounted) will be
incorporated into these classes.  Riders will have the
opportunity (only if you want to) to switch horses
several times during the class.  
Purpose:
To allow riders to achieve "connection" with their horses
in a different setting.  As most of you know, most of the
lessons I teach are private.  So, providing these classes
will give riders an opportunity to do things a little
different and increase awareness in other areas.  Riding
in a group setting is really fun and brings new
challenges.  
Please note:
No one is required to switch horses.  It is just a fun
experience for some people to apply what they are learning
on different horses.  Please let me know if you do not want
to switch horses.  This just helps me plan to make sure
the class runs smoothly.
